Specs/Key Features:
  • Next-gen WiFi standard - Ultrafast WiFi 7 (802.11be) tri-band WiFi router boosts speeds up to 19,000 Mbps
  • 2.4X higher speed with lower signal delays and interference - 6 GHz with new 320 MHz bandwidth & 4096-QAM
  • Dual 10 Gb ports - Enjoy up to 10X-faster data transfer speeds for bandwidth-demanding tasks with two 10 Gbps WAN/LAN ports
  • Multi-link connection - Link to multiple bands at the same time to ensure stable internet connections and efficient data transfers
  • Commercial-grade network security - The latest ASUS technologies protect you from multiple types of threats

If you don't need Wifi7, GLiNet MT6000 router have very good range (good signal 2000sq home + 100' yard) and easy to setup like Asus. It has built-in Adguard home, Tailscale, ZeroTier, OpenVPN, Wireguard VPN, and Tor. The MT6000 router have dual GLiNet GUI and Luci OpenWRT Snapshot. If you don't like stock firmware, full OpenWRT and Tomato64 are available.
